Pipestone National Monument stands proudly in southwestern Minnesota, a unique destination renowned for its striking red quartzite formations. These rocks have been sculpted over time, offering a dramatic landscape that's both a geological wonder and a cultural treasure. This area has been a sacred site for Native American tribes who have quarried the soft red stone to craft ceremonial pipes, a tradition still honored today.
The monument reveals a rich connection between the natural world and cultural history. Explore the vibrant layers of quartzite formations, adorned with native prairie grasses and interspersed with scenic trails. This location is not just a feast for the eyes, but a vital locale for understanding Native American cultural practices and history.
Visitors to Pipestone National Monument are greeted by the harmonious blend of geology and spirituality, offering a rare connection to the Earth's past and present. Embark on this journey and experience the landscape where stories have been carved in stone for generations.
